From: "airman@appledumplings.com" <airman@appledumplings.com> --> TeamGrumman-List message posted by: "airman@appledumplings.com" <airman@appledumplings.com> I wrote a month ago about an oil temp issue. This is an update. I live near atlanta and I have a 1976 aa5b O-360 with 300 SMOH that I have owned since march. Since the weather has warmed up my oil temps have been running about 1.5 to 2 needle widths from the red- line. The things I have done to try to resolve this issue are: I replaced baffle seals. I fixed the inter cylinder baffles that were not wired together. We just recently pulled the vernatherm and it looked to be seated correctly and operated as expected when we checked it. We also checked the gauge. Unfortunately it seems to reading low not high! We are now checking the timing. The only thing I can think of left is the Oil cooler. Which brings me to this question. What are my options? I think i am just going to go with a new oil cooler rather than re-condition. Are there any STC's for a larger cooler and if so can someone send me that info? Have any of you guys had field approvals for a different cooler?
